Hi,  I am a fairly new trello user and to find a card I often use the search feature at the top of the page.  I have noticed that not all information in the card is included as part of the search.  For example I had a project number saved in a custom field and a search for that project number did not return anything.  I added the number to the card's description and still nothing.  1st question: does anyone know which of the card's fields are included in the standard search, and 2nd: Is there any way to expand the search to include all information on a card?

Hey Sierk

Currently, Custom Fields are not searchable. Hopefully that is implemented soon!  

For searching in the description of a card, you'll need to use the description:keyword operator, where the search will find cards with the word Keyword that is in the description. Here's a general breakdown of searching within Trello. Check out Super Search as well :)
